ID: ENSBTAT00000026362
DBxRefs: refseq:XM_059877544 refseq:XP_059733527 refseq:XP_005219448 refseq:XM_005219391
Gene: ENSBTAG00000019785 capicua transcriptional repressor [Source:VGNC Symbol;Acc:VGNC:27363]
Polypeptide: ENSBTAT00000026362
18:50982135..50994009 -1